New picture editor for PA ahead of Olympics

The Press Association has appointed a new picture editor as it prepares to take on the role of  host national news agency for the London 2012 Olympics

In her new role Milica Lamb will oversee and direct PA’s photographic output on a day-to-day basis, as well as around major events – including the Games.

A former head of PA Photos (now Press Association Images) for 12 years, Milica has also held senior roles at EPA, News Team International and Abaca USA, before returning to PA as Business Development Director for Press Association Images last year.

PA editor  Jonathan Grun asid:  “Milica’s combination of editorial and commercial experience make her ideally suited to the role of Picture Editor.  With the eyes of the world on London for the Olympics, this year is going to be both exciting and challenging and I have no doubt that Milica will be a great asset to our team.”

Milica added:  “I am thrilled to be taking on the role of Picture Editor.  PA’s photographers are phenomenally talented and working with them on a daily basis is a real honour.

“With the Diamond Jubilee and the Olympics coming up in the next few months, it’s a busy time at PA and I’m looking forward to working with the rest of the newsroom to provide the best multimedia coverage we can.”
